Everest Base Camp Trekking is all about getting to some of the highest navigable points on Earth. The trek , one of the most iconic trekking in Nepal, takes you to the very base of Mt. Everest through the exceptional landscape of Everest region with cultural richness of highland Sherpa settlements and monasteries; and the natural wonders of Himalayan giants including Everest, Lhotse, Makalu, AmaDablam, Cho-Oyu etc. The trip, which is undoubtedly the best trekking in the Himalaya, starts with a day of exploration in the treasure troves of Kathmandu and continues with an electrifying flight to the airport in Lukla, which hangs on the edge of the cliff at 2860m. From Lukla, the gateway to the Everest region, the trip winds through the floral and faunal richness of Sagarmatha National Park, while at the same time following the spectacular views of Himalayan giants including Mt. Everest (8848m), Mt. Lhotse (8586m), Mt. Cho Oyu (8188m) and Mt. AmaDablam (6812m). Not just the natural grandeur, once the trail starts ascending, you will also get deeper and deeper into the astounding cultural highlights of highland Sherpa villages.
